Kinds of Oilfield Substances
one. Cementing Additives
Cementing additives are accustomed to Increase the Houses of cement slurry in properly cementing operations. They increase the overall performance of cement by furnishing:

Rheology Regulate: Ensuring appropriate move and placement.
Fluid reduction Manage: Blocking loss of fluids towards the formation.
Location time adjustment: Controlling the hardening rate from the cement.
2. Acid Stimulation Additives
Acid stimulation is made use of to boost effectively efficiency by dissolving minerals that block the movement of hydrocarbons. Additives in acid stimulation consist of:

Corrosion inhibitors: Shielding the wellbore and gear.
Surfactants: Increasing acid penetration and performance.
Iron Regulate agents: Stopping precipitation of iron compounds.
three. Drilling Fluid Additives
Drilling fluid additives are essential for preserving very well stability and productive drilling operations. They incorporate:

Viscosifiers: Increasing the viscosity of drilling fluids.
Shale inhibitors: Preventing the swelling of shale formations.
Fluid loss additives: Decreasing the loss of drilling fluids on the development.
4. Completion Additives
Completion additives are made use of during the completion stage to make sure the properly is thoroughly prepared for production. These additives consist of:

Sand Handle brokers: Blocking sand output.
Scale inhibitors: Blocking the development of scale deposits.
Biocides: Doing away with Fluid Loss Control Additives harmful bacteria.
Specialised Oilfield Substances
one. Oil Recovery Additives
Oil Restoration additives enrich the extraction of oil from reservoirs. They include things like:

Surfactants: Cutting down interfacial pressure to mobilize trapped oil.
Polymers: Rising the viscosity of injected drinking water to enhance sweep efficiency.
two. Demulsifiers
Demulsifiers are utilized to individual water from crude oil. They are really critical in:

Crude oil demulsification: Breaking down emulsions to boost oil top quality.
Drinking water treatment: Maximizing the separation of oil and drinking water in manufactured fluids.
3. Specialty Chemical Additives
Specialty chemical additives cater to unique issues in oilfield operations. They involve:

Corrosion inhibitors: Shielding steel surfaces from corrosive fluids.
Paraffin inhibitors: Preventing the deposition of paraffin wax in pipelines.
Hydrate inhibitors: Blocking the development of gasoline hydrates.
